Create New Tag

6/25/2013 11:03 PM

I just tried the fly bikes cobra tube and this is the most convenient tube ever but their so expensive. so i was wondering are their any other tubes like this


making half retarded post at the moment

6/25/2013 11:05 PM

No their isn't, I think Fly patented it. It's a good idea but yeah it's too expensive. I think the problem is that every other tube is made a few companies in Taiwan that makes a lot of the same tubes, where as the Cobra Tube is different.